Actor who played the role of Jim Phelps on TVs Mission Impossible in both the original from 1967-1973 and its revival from 1988-1990. In 1953, he performed as Sgt. In 1955, Graves was cast in several movies, such as The Long Gray Line, Wichita, The Night of the Hunter, and The Court Martial of Billy Mitchell. In the same year, he bagged a major role in the television series Fury, which was telecast on the NBC channel. Peter Graves was born Peter Duesler Aurness on March 18, 1926 on Minneapolis, Minnesota. In the 1970s, Graves performed in several television movies, such as Call to Danger, The Presidents Plane Is Missing, and Scream of the Wolf. In 1983, he portrayed Palmer Kirby, in the miniseries The Winds of War. Graves' first television series was the children's Saturday morning show, "Fury," about an orphan and his untamed black stallion. In 1959, Peter Graves appeared as Christopher Cobb, in the British TV series Whiplash. It was aired on the ATV, ITC Entertainment, and Seven Network channels.
